News
The Italian sportsman Mattia Debertolis has died after featuring in a foot orienteering event at the World Games in China’s ...
Time Walker on MSN47m
Walking in the busy streets of the metropolis – Chengdu, China 4K
Captured in 4K, this video shows Chengdu, China’s urban scenery and daily activity in the city center. Tennis world sends ...
Time Walker on MSN47m
Walking route through vibrant downtown – Chengdu, China 4K
This walk takes you through Chengdu, China’s lively streets filled with shops, restaurants, and city life. Tennis world sends 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results